Transaction 7125888d58e85e3ec7f391121f7352abbbd22c047a55cc1997112d8c27ea2f31
1 Input
1 Output
-
7125888d58e85e3ec7f391121f7352abbbd22c047a55cc1997112d8c27ea2f31:0
- value
- 69990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a14ccca971754bb571642e39202321ec497c8b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 16J77LKk599PcwkdE7f6H8ES2c4r8duhyD